For the purpose of finding the optimum conditions of biogenetic-type synthesis of onocerin from squalene 2, 3; 22, 23-dioxide (IV), acid-catalyzed cyclization (BF3-etherate in water-saturated benzene) of squalene-2, 3-oxide (I) was investigated to afford the compounds, III, V, VI, VII, VIII and IX. The gross structure of these compounds was established by physical and chemical evidences. The cyclization of IV was also tried.
